Design of a Bluetooth Car Based on STM32

Design of a Bluetooth Car Based on STM32

Click the blue text to follow us

Design of a Bluetooth Car Based on STM32

Design of a Bluetooth Car Based on STM32

(Program + Simulation + Reference Report)

01

Function Introduction

Function:

The entire car is powered by a 12V power supply, controlled by a white switch for overall power on and off. The motor drive uses the TB6612FNG module, and there are two control modes: button mode and Bluetooth mode. The Bluetooth module uses the HC-05 module, and ultrasonic distance measurement is done using the HC-SR04 module for automatic obstacle avoidance. A display screen is also needed to show the current mode, status, and measured distance. Proteus itself does not support Bluetooth simulation, so I use a virtual serial port to simulate Bluetooth control.

Design of a Bluetooth Car Based on STM32Design of a Bluetooth Car Based on STM32

02

Design Materials

01

Simulation Diagram

This design uses Proteus version 8.15, which is backward compatible with higher versions. The simulation is shown in the figure!

Design of a Bluetooth Car Based on STM32

02

Program

The recommended programming software for this design is Keil5, as shown in the figure!

Design of a Bluetooth Car Based on STM32

03

Reference Report

The following is the reference report, with a total of 10,387 words, detailed as follows!

Design of a Bluetooth Car Based on STM32

04

Design Materials

All materials including programs (with comments), simulation source files, etc., are detailed as follows.

Design of a Bluetooth Car Based on STM32Design of a Bluetooth Car Based on STM32

Material Acquisition

Design of a Bluetooth Car Based on STM32

Like and share, let’s improve together

Download link for all materials

Design of a Bluetooth Car Based on STM32Design of a Bluetooth Car Based on STM32

Or click “Read the original text” to obtain the materials

Leave a Comment